Encore Renewable Energy is seeking a detail-oriented Project Accountant to join our Accounting team. This role will be responsible for the accounting and financial management of our community solar and energy storage portfolio, supporting projects from early development through long-term operations. In this position, you will play a critical role in ensuring that project costs are recorded, classified, and capitalized accurately. This is essential not only for reporting and compliance, but also for unlocking the full value of federal Investment Tax Credits (ITC) and other renewable energy incentives. Your work will directly support Encore’s mission to deliver clean energy projects while maximizing economic returns. This highly visible role offers significant cross-functional collaboration with Project Management, Construction Management, and external partners including third-party appraisers and auditors. You will gain hands-on experience in renewable energy project finance, tax credit compliance, and portfolio-level accounting, positioning yourself at the intersection of clean energy, accounting, and impact investing. For candidates motivated to build scalable processes that deliver accurate results, this role provides the opportunity to apply your accounting expertise in support of a purpose-driven mission to combat climate change.

  • Manage full-cycle project accounting for the community solar and energy storage portfolio, maintaining accurate and up-to-date financial records throughout each project’s lifecycle.
  • Be the primary accounting point of contact for Business Development, Project Management, and Construction, bridging project execution with financial accuracy.
  • Ensure proper project cost allocation and compliance with GAAP, with a focus on accuracy for tax equity and ITC substantiation.
  • Reconcile project costs between the general ledger and the project cost tracking system (SiteTracker), ensuring data integrity.
  • Enhance budget vs. actual reporting tools and processes, creating clear, insightful variance analyses to support project managers, leadership, and external stakeholders.
  • Support external audits by preparing documentation, schedules, and detailed financial analyses.
  • Identify process bottlenecks and implement solutions to improve efficiency, accuracy, and scalability in project accounting and reporting.
  • Drive efficiency and compliance by identifying opportunities to streamline project accounting and enhance ITC/tax reporting processes.
  • Provide actionable financial insights to improve project performance, support decision-making, and maximize economic returns.
